Something good happens to Maccabi Netanya when they meet Maccabi Tel Aviv.
In the first round the Diamonds defeated the trophy holder with impressive ability, and they were not far from beating it in tonight's game (Saturday) either, but in the end settled for a precious point in Bloomfield.
Bnei Lem's team, which was sitting in the stands due to dismissal, pressed hard on the host and climbed to a justified advantage after Parfa Guigon cooked for Aviv Avraham.
In one of the Yellows' few attacks, Gabi Kanikovsky, the diamond ex, managed to equalize and he did not celebrate after the goal he scored, of course.
A serious mistake by Danny Amos on the verge of the half, allowed Guerrero to score the second to win Maccabi.
The second half was all about Netanya.
A random corner kick hit Ophir Davidzada and equalized.
Netanya continued to look for the third and came again and again to good situations but missed.
In this half, Maccabi mentioned the weak and confused team before the Krastich era, and as mentioned, only with great luck did they not lose the game.
This performance by Maccabi Tel Aviv proved once again that the current staff of the Yellows is not good enough, and without changes in the dream of transfers, their war for third place will also be very difficult.
